Cycling routes from Bosschenhoofd

Bosschenhoofd is a village located in the region of Noord-Brabant, Netherlands. For road and gravel cyclists, Bosschenhoofd provides access to several cycling routes that pass through the beautiful countryside of Noord-Brabant. The flat terrain and wide roads make it a suitable area for both leisurely rides and more intense training sessions. However, Bosschenhoofd does not have any iconic cycling spots or well-known climbs nearby. Despite this, it offers a peaceful and enjoyable cycling experience for enthusiasts.
